      1) He said he went in the middle of the afternoon on a weekday. Not even the local kids are out of school yet.
      2) This is technically a Tadaya, a small local store that Surugaya partnered with, so it is not a full Surugaya-brand store. This Tadaya is located in Fukiage out in the middle of nowhere Saitama, quite a distance away from the nearest train station, so you're not going to see that many non-locals way out there. Unlike the Surugaya stores in Tokyo, this store won't see any foreign tourists there throughout the day.

      On average, the pricing are a tad higher on certain goods. On the other hand, the prices are not too bad for those coming into japan with dollars, euros, pounds, etc. Also, the prices I quote include a 10% sales tax that doesn’t apply to tourists. Surugaya, as I understand it, is a tax free shop. Cheers!
